I acquired a Savage 1899 short rifle in 25-35 a few years ago (haven't fired it yet) and collected a few online articles on the caliber. Only one referenced trying to re-form brass (from 30-30) and he reported that case failure was high with the dies he had, and subsequently gave up on case-forming.
